Summary
The documentation page generally maintains parity between Windows and Linux, but there are subtle signs of Windows bias. The VHD preparation section links only to Windows-specific instructions, with no equivalent Linux VHD preparation guidance. Additionally, the password complexity requirements link to a Windows VM FAQ, not a Linux equivalent. While both OS types are mentioned for VM creation and connection, Windows examples and references tend to appear first or exclusively in some critical steps.
Recommendations
  • Add a link or section for preparing a generalized Linux VHD, similar to the Windows VHD preparation guidance.
  • Include Linux-specific password requirements or clarify if the linked Windows requirements apply to Linux VMs.
  • Ensure that examples and references for Linux are presented alongside Windows, not after or omitted.
  • Review referenced includes (e.g., connection instructions) to confirm Linux instructions are as detailed and accessible as Windows ones.
